Jump to content
  • Welcome To FMForums

    Welcome to our community, full of great ideas on developing your FileMaker solutions effectively,
     for peer-to-peer support of the FileMaker Platform and related products and services.

    Register and join the conversation!

     

    fmf AD.jpg

     

     

Blogs

Featured Entries

  • Josh Ormond

    A Conversation About '2 Factor Authentication'

    By Josh Ormond

    [ Edit: 3/16/2016 - With the help of some other people, we have been able to recover, or recreate some of the original images from original thread. ] Security is always a big topic when it involves data, or people, or possessions. Recently, over on the FileMaker Community, there was a very beneficial discussion regarding security. Unfortunately, that discussion was the victim of a necessary action...and was deleted. It was deleted, because the discussion was tied to a video that, as was det
    • 1 comment
    • 5,153 views
  • Steven H. Blackwell

    Hacking Your Own FileMaker Platform Solutions

    By Steven H. Blackwell

    Hacking Your Own FileMaker Platform Solutions Should FileMaker Platform developers mount hacking attacks on their own solutions? At first glance, this may seem an odd question. But I believe that the answer is “Yes, we should.” Consider this. As developers we see our solutions from a totally different perspective than Threat Agents see them. Without practicing our own hacking skills, we can become blind to the vulnerabilities a Threat Agent can exploit to compromise the Confidentiality
    • 1 comment
    • 5,010 views

Scripting Primer

What is FileMaker Pro scripting? It can be defined as automation, a macro and even a programming language. FileMaker Pro scripting has elements of all these definitions. The original purpose of scripting was to automate the mundane task of printing a report. Since it repeats most of the items under the menus, it can also be considered a macro language. Yet, it is so much more! With logical branching, it can even be considered a programming language. The FileMaker Pro Script Workspace is a beauti

John Mark Osborne

John Mark Osborne

Copy & Paste Portal Rows

There’s an addictive quality to solving problems within FileMaker. Especially, when you wire things up to the user interface. Click the button, and what would have taken many times longer, is shortened into a few milliseconds of time. It quite literally feels like you’re a magician - at least to this developer. So, when developing a solution the other day, and needing to copy the contents of one portal over to another, I quickly came up with a solution and put it into place. Within about a hal

FileMaker Magazine

FileMaker Magazine

Copy & Paste Portal Rows

There’s an addictive quality to solving problems within FileMaker. Especially, when you wire things up to the user interface. Click the button, and what would have taken many times longer, is shortened into a few milliseconds of time. It quite literally feels like you’re a magician - at least to this developer. So, when developing a solution the other day, and needing to copy the contents of one portal over to another, I quickly came up with a solution and put it into place. Within about a hal

FileMaker Magazine

FileMaker Magazine

Camera Rental Company Zooms In On Inventory Control Using FileMaker Pro

Blockbuster Rental-Tracking Inventory App Sharpens Booking Process, Cuts Equipment Retrieval and Check-in Times During Hollywood’s rapid fade-out of 35-millimeter film, camera operator Neal Norton saw an opportunity to make money in the digital retooling of the industry. The year was 2010 and the German-made Arri ALEXA had just hit the market, providing a viable digital alternative to celluloid film. Norton decided to take action. He partnered with cinematographer Alan Degen to found Gulf

eXcelisys

eXcelisys

Finding FileMaker Talent

Recruiting FileMaker talent isn't always as easy it may seem. Productive Computing tells you how they succeed in growing talent out of college graduates. With short presentations of the capabilities of FileMaker and discussions about their company, Marc Larochelle is able get graduating students at a local university interested in a career in FileMaker. "There’s really nothing more rewarding than seeing the next generation of FileMaker developers come alive with the same enthusiasm and inspirati

John Mark Osborne

John Mark Osborne

Live Stream: Nicholas Orr presents BaseElements

Nicholas Orr from Goya presented at our developer meeting this month. Watch the recording of the live-stream to see him demonstrate BaseElements and give a run down on the benefits of developer analysis tools in general, and BaseElements in particular.  He’ll show you how to get the best solution possible from FileMaker using these tools, as well a quick demo of their update builder product : RefreshFM, Web Services server : RESTfm and the free BaseElements plugin.   View the full article

Smef

Smef

Custom Function Database - Part 9

Heading back into our series on the Custom Function database, there’s always an opportunity to explore yet another area of using FileMaker to create solid solutions. This video focuses on the fact that we’re storing canonical data which we want to leverage, yet not alter. When you store data for any type of templating system or data which acts as the basis for further variations you have a number of choices in terms of how users interact with that data. For this solution we want the user to be

FileMaker Magazine

FileMaker Magazine

Custom Function Database - Part 9

Heading back into our series on the Custom Function database, there’s always an opportunity to explore yet another area of using FileMaker to create solid solutions. This video focuses on the fact that we’re storing canonical data which we want to leverage, yet not alter. When you store data for any type of templating system or data which acts as the basis for further variations you have a number of choices in terms of how users interact with that data. For this solution we want the user to be

FileMaker Magazine

FileMaker Magazine

KISS

In the last few years, I've subscribed to the KISS methodology (Keep It Simple Stupid). Call it wisdom or humility, I'm not sure which. All I know is, after over two decades in the FileMaker market, I've discovered the simplest solution is most often best for my clients. It costs less and performs better, in most cases. I know all the tricks, having practically wrote the book on the subject, but there is a time and a place for complex methods. What I'm here to convince you is, choose complicated

John Mark Osborne

John Mark Osborne

FileMaker QuickBooks Online Integration

Many companies use both QuickBooks and FileMaker end up having to do double data entry from one system to the next. In this article, we will demonstrate how you can eliminate the hassle of manually copying the information by integrating your FileMaker solution with QuickBooks online. Includes demo and sample file: https://dbservices.com/articles/filemaker-quickbooks-online-integration/ dbservices.com

User-Friendly Excel Exports, part 7

This is a follow up to last week’s part 6, with three refinements. Demo 1 (Excel Exports, v7a) – fixes a numeric formatting bug Demo 2 (Excel Exports, v7b) – offers a more flexible Excel export “save” dialog Demo 3 (Excel Exports, v7c) – uses ExecuteSQL to reduce the # of TOs on the RG […] View the full article

Kevin Frank

Kevin Frank

KISS

In the last few years, I've subscribed to the KISS methodology (Keep It Simple Stupid). Call it wisdom or humility, I'm not sure which. All I know is, after over two decades in the FileMaker market, I've discovered the simplest solution is most often best for my clients. It costs less and performs better, in most cases. I know all the tricks, having practically wrote the book on the subject, but there is a time and a place for complex methods. What I'm here to convince you is, choose complicated

John Mark Osborne

John Mark Osborne

Geologist Fuels Consulting Biz by Drilling Deeper Into FileMaker Web Technology

FileMaker® Pro / WebDirect: FileMaker Web Subscription Service Keeps Oil Field and Reservoir Data Flowing to Prospectors 24/7 Just because your business involves fossil fuels, the technology you rely on doesn’t need to be a fossil too. A new FileMaker web solution brings new technology to finding an old resource.  In the United States, the average person consumes about 2.5 gallons of crude oil per day — or 22 barrels per year. Offshore oil production helps meet this need. According to the U

eXcelisys

eXcelisys

Ultimate Find

When I first started teaching FileMaker scripting, I went through the entire list of script steps and provided a simple example of each one. By the end of the third day, we had covered every script step but with no depth. More questions remained than were answered. That’s when I decided to focus on the most important steps. Instead of spending valuable time teaching scripts steps most people would never use in real life scenarios, I decided to concentrate on steps that are used over and over and

John Mark Osborne

John Mark Osborne

Ultimate Find

When I first started teaching FileMaker scripting, I went through the entire list of script steps and provided a simple example of each one. By the end of the third day, we had covered every script step but with no depth. More questions remained than were answered. That’s when I decided to focus on the most important steps. Instead of spending valuable time teaching scripts steps most people would never use in real life scenarios, I decided to concentrate on steps that are used over and over and

John Mark Osborne

John Mark Osborne

User-Friendly Excel Exports, part 6

Recently I was asked to implement user-friendly Excel exports on a WAN-based solution, utilizing some of the techniques explored earlier in this series (part 1, part 1.1, part 2, part 3, part 4 and part 5 — all from five years ago). There was just one problem: while performance was great locally, and okay on a LAN, it was […] View the full article

Kevin Frank

Kevin Frank

Basics Before You Purchase a WordPress Theme

WordPress Theme Considerations By: Fred Morgan WordPress originally began life as a blogging engine, but over time has matured into not only a great content management system (CMS), but also a full-fledged application development framework.  Consequently, WordPress holds the lion’s share of the CMS market and its widespread use has spurred the development of countless WordPress themes and plugins to extend its feature set.  However, not all WordPress themes and plugins are created equal

eXcelisys

eXcelisys

Checkmarking Sub-ranges in List Views

One of the most enjoyable things about working in FileMaker, or any development environment where looping is supported, is the pure joy of automation. Even thinking about checking off any more than a few records at a time brings me to a mental state of counting the number of seconds it takes for the single action itself, then multiplying times the number of objects I need to affect. So the question arrives. “How do I automate this?” or “How do I make this process easier for the user?”. The ans

FileMaker Magazine

FileMaker Magazine

Checkmarking Sub-ranges in List Views

One of the most enjoyable things about working in FileMaker, or any development environment where looping is supported, is the pure joy of automation. Even thinking about checking off any more than a few records at a time brings me to a mental state of counting the number of seconds it takes for the single action itself, then multiplying times the number of objects I need to affect. So the question arrives. “How do I automate this?” or “How do I make this process easier for the user?”. The ans

FileMaker Magazine

FileMaker Magazine

Robust FileMaker Design

Have you ever inherited a system built by someone else, changed a field’s name and everything stopped working? The issue, hardcoded names used in indirection, makes the system fragile. FileMaker provides developers many methods to add flexibility using indirection. However when these instances of indirection are not treated properly they will raise all sorts of problems. In this article we will discuss good practices regarding indirection that will help you build a dynamic and robust FileMaker s

John Mark Osborne

John Mark Osborne

Robust FileMaker Design

Have you ever inherited a system built by someone else, changed a field’s name and everything stopped working? The issue, hardcoded names used in indirection, makes the system fragile. FileMaker provides developers many methods to add flexibility using indirection. However when these instances of indirection are not treated properly they will raise all sorts of problems. In this article we will discuss good practices regarding indirection that will help you build a dynamic and robust FileMaker s

John Mark Osborne

John Mark Osborne

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use.